(the “Company” or “Barfresh”) (OTCQB: BRFH), a provider of frozen, ready-to-blend and ready-to-drink beverages, achieved a significant milestone with the Los Angeles Unified School District (“LAUSD”) approving Barfresh’s Twist & Go product and adding it to their menu starting this month. LAUSD is the largest school district in California and the second largest school district in the country, serving over 600,000 students in kindergarten through 12th grade. Initially Barfresh expects Twist & Go to be on the LAUSD menu approximately once every three to four weeks and hopes to grow to multiple times per month. Based on input from LAUSD, Barfresh estimates serving approximately 100,000 bottles per menu day during the current period which currently has school attendance limited due to virus related restrictions. As schools return to normal capacity, Barfresh expects daily bottle servings to rise to 350,000 to 400,000 per menu day.
